How a Mangaluru Trans Woman Went From Begging on the Streets To Owning Autos & Becoming a Gym Trainer
From being called Ajibabu to now Ani Mangaluru – Here is the story of a transgender person, who was discriminated against and denied basic rights.
Born in a poverty-stricken family in Hiredinni camp in Maski, Raichur, along with four other siblings, Ajibabu always felt feminine. She was determined to study and secured a seat on merit for a Bachelor’s in Education in Mangaluru.
